Putin flicked Zelensky on the nose
The decision of the President of the Russian Federation Vladimir Putin to issue Russian passports to residents of the Donbass republics is a “click” on the nose of the new head of the Ukrainian state, Vladimir Zelensky.
This was stated during a meeting with readers at the Moscow Art Theater by the adviser to the deceased leader of Donbass Alexander Zakharchenko, writer Zakhar Prilepin,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ports.
“Zelensky was elected president, there was no inauguration yet, and he was talking about how he would return Donbass, began to make some radical statements, and they clicked on his nose and said: “Here is the certification of the entire DPR and LPR - go ahead, return it now.” their".
I thought it was witty that some people in the Russian government have such a slightly cynical sense of humor,” Prilepin said.
